until HaShem give rest unto your brethren, as unto you, and they also possess the land which HaShem your G-d giveth them beyond the Jordan; then shall ye return every man unto his possession, which I have given you.
21
And I commanded Joshua at that time, saying: 'Thine eyes have seen all that HaShem your G-d hath done unto these two kings; so shall HaShem do unto all the kingdoms whither thou goest over.
22
Ye shall not fear them; for HaShem your G-d, He it is that fighteth for you.'
23
And I besought HaShem at that time, saying:
24
'O L-rd GOD, Thou hast begun to show Thy servant Thy greatness, and Thy strong hand; for what god is there in heaven or on earth, that can do according to Thy works, and according to Thy mighty acts?
25
Let me go over, I pray Thee, and see the good land that is beyond the Jordan, that goodly hill-country, and Lebanon.'
26
But HaShem was wroth with me for your sakes, and hearkened not unto me; and HaShem said unto me: 'Let it suffice thee; speak no more unto Me of this matter.
27
Get thee up into the top of Pisgah, and lift up thine eyes westward, and northward, and southward, and eastward, and behold with thine eyes; for thou shalt not go over this Jordan.
28
But charge Joshua, and encourage him, and strengthen him; for he shall go over before this people, and he shall cause them to inherit the land which thou shalt see.'
29
So we abode in the valley over against Beth-peor.
